@charset "utf-8";/* default styles for extension "tx_cssstyledcontent" *//* Captions */  DIV.csc-textpic-caption-c .csc-textpic-caption{ text-align: center; }  DIV.csc-textpic-caption-r .csc-textpic-caption{ text-align: right; }  DIV.csc-textpic-caption-l .csc-textpic-caption{ text-align: left; }  /* Needed for noRows setting */  DIV.csc-textpic DIV.csc-textpic-imagecolumn{ float: left; display: inline; }  /* Border just around the image */  DIV.csc-textpic-border DIV.csc-textpic-imagewrap .csc-textpic-image IMG{  border: 2px solid black;    padding: 0px 0px;  }  DIV.csc-textpic-imagewrap{ padding: 0; }  DIV.csc-textpic IMG{ border: none; }  /* DIV: This will place the images side by side */  DIV.csc-textpic DIV.csc-textpic-imagewrap DIV.csc-textpic-image{ float: left; }  /* UL: This will place the images side by side */  DIV.csc-textpic DIV.csc-textpic-imagewrap UL{ list-style: none; margin: 0; padding: 0; }  DIV.csc-textpic DIV.csc-textpic-imagewrap UL LI{ float: left; margin: 0; padding: 0; }  /* DL: This will place the images side by side */  DIV.csc-textpic DIV.csc-textpic-imagewrap DL.csc-textpic-image{ float: left; }  DIV.csc-textpic DIV.csc-textpic-imagewrap DL.csc-textpic-image DT{ float: none; }  DIV.csc-textpic DIV.csc-textpic-imagewrap DL.csc-textpic-image DD{ float: none; }  DIV.csc-textpic DIV.csc-textpic-imagewrap DL.csc-textpic-image DD IMG{ border: none; } /* FE-Editing Icons */  DL.csc-textpic-image{ margin: 0; }  DL.csc-textpic-image DT{ margin: 0; display: inline; }  DL.csc-textpic-image DD{ margin: 0; }  /* Clearer */  DIV.csc-textpic-clear{ clear: both; }  /* Margins around images: */  /* Pictures on left, add margin on right */  DIV.csc-textpic-left DIV.csc-textpic-imagewrap .csc-textpic-image,  DIV.csc-textpic-intext-left-nowrap DIV.csc-textpic-imagewrap .csc-textpic-image,  DIV.csc-textpic-intext-left DIV.csc-textpic-imagewrap .csc-textpic-image{  display: inline; /* IE fix for double-margin bug */    margin-right: 10px;  }  /* Pictures on right, add margin on left */  DIV.csc-textpic-right DIV.csc-textpic-imagewrap .csc-textpic-image,  DIV.csc-textpic-intext-right-nowrap DIV.csc-textpic-imagewrap .csc-textpic-image,  DIV.csc-textpic-intext-right DIV.csc-textpic-imagewrap .csc-textpic-image{  display: inline; /* IE fix for double-margin bug */    margin-left: 10px;  }  /* Pictures centered, add margin on left */  DIV.csc-textpic-center DIV.csc-textpic-imagewrap .csc-textpic-image{  display: inline; /* IE fix for double-margin bug */    margin-left: 10px;  }  DIV.csc-textpic DIV.csc-textpic-imagewrap .csc-textpic-image .csc-textpic-caption{ margin: 0; }  DIV.csc-textpic DIV.csc-textpic-imagewrap .csc-textpic-image IMG{ margin: 0; }  /* Space below each image (also in-between rows) */  DIV.csc-textpic DIV.csc-textpic-imagewrap .csc-textpic-image{ margin-bottom: 5px; }  DIV.csc-textpic-equalheight DIV.csc-textpic-imagerow{ margin-bottom: 5px; display: block; }  DIV.csc-textpic DIV.csc-textpic-imagerow{ clear: both; }  /* No margins around the whole image-block */  DIV.csc-textpic DIV.csc-textpic-imagewrap .csc-textpic-firstcol{ margin-left: 0px !important; }  DIV.csc-textpic DIV.csc-textpic-imagewrap .csc-textpic-lastcol{ margin-right: 0px !important; }  /* Add margin from image-block to text (in case of "Text w/ images") */  DIV.csc-textpic-intext-left DIV.csc-textpic-imagewrap,  DIV.csc-textpic-intext-left-nowrap DIV.csc-textpic-imagewrap{  margin-right: 10px !important;  }  DIV.csc-textpic-intext-right DIV.csc-textpic-imagewrap,  DIV.csc-textpic-intext-right-nowrap DIV.csc-textpic-imagewrap{  margin-left: 10px !important;  }  /* Positioning of images: */  /* Above */  DIV.csc-textpic-above DIV.csc-textpic-text{ clear: both; }  /* Center (above or below) */  DIV.csc-textpic-center{ text-align: center; /* IE-hack */ }  DIV.csc-textpic-center DIV.csc-textpic-imagewrap{ margin: 0 auto; }  DIV.csc-textpic-center DIV.csc-textpic-imagewrap .csc-textpic-image{ text-align: left; /* Remove IE-hack */ }  DIV.csc-textpic-center DIV.csc-textpic-text{ text-align: left; /* Remove IE-hack */ }  /* Right (above or below) */  DIV.csc-textpic-right DIV.csc-textpic-imagewrap{ float: right; }  DIV.csc-textpic-right DIV.csc-textpic-text{ clear: right; }  /* Left (above or below) */  DIV.csc-textpic-left DIV.csc-textpic-imagewrap{ float: left; }  DIV.csc-textpic-left DIV.csc-textpic-text{ clear: left; }  /* Left (in text) */  DIV.csc-textpic-intext-left DIV.csc-textpic-imagewrap{ float: left; }  /* Right (in text) */  DIV.csc-textpic-intext-right DIV.csc-textpic-imagewrap{ float: right; }  /* Right (in text, no wrap around) */  DIV.csc-textpic-intext-right-nowrap DIV.csc-textpic-imagewrap{ float: right; clear: both; }  /* Hide from IE5-mac. Only IE-win sees this. \*/  * html DIV.csc-textpic-intext-right-nowrap .csc-textpic-text{ height: 1%; }  /* End hide from IE5/mac */  /* Left (in text, no wrap around) */  DIV.csc-textpic-intext-left-nowrap DIV.csc-textpic-imagewrap{ float: left; clear: both; }  /* Hide from IE5-mac. Only IE-win sees this. \*/  * html DIV.csc-textpic-intext-left-nowrap .csc-textpic-text{ height: 1%; }  /* End hide from IE5/mac */    /* Browser fixes: */    /* Fix for unordered and ordered list with image "In text, left" */  .csc-textpic-intext-left ol, .csc-textpic-intext-left ul{ padding-left: 40px; overflow: auto; height: 1%; }DIV.csc-textpic DIV.csc-textpic-imagerow-last{ margin-bottom: 0; }

body{font-size:16px;font-family: "Trebuchet MS", Arial, Helvetica, sans-serif; margin: 0; padding: 0; background: #04b4a9 url(bg-liever-een-fret.jpg) top center no-repeat;background-attachment:fixed;text-align: center;color: #000000;}
.wrap #container{width: 800px;  margin: 0 auto;  text-align: left;} 
.wrap #header{margin:0; padding: 0 10px 0 0;  width:800px;  clear:right;}
.csc-default{background:#fff;
-moz-box-shadow: 0 0 2px 2px #1f1a14;
-webkit-box-shadow: 0 0 2px 2px #1f1a14;
box-shadow: 0 0 2px 2px #1f1a14;
}
#c229.csc-default,#c723.csc-default,#c657.csc-default{background:none;
-moz-box-shadow: none;
-webkit-box-shadow: none;
box-shadow: none;
}
.wrap #header h1{margin: 0; /* zeroing the margin of the last element in the #header div will avoid margin collapse - an unexplainable space between divs. If the div has a border around it, this is not necessary as that also avoids the margin collapse */  padding: 10px 0; /* using padding instead of margin will allow you to keep the element away from the edges of the div */}
.wrap #sidebar1{float:right; width:200px; padding:85px 10px; font-size:12px; overflow:hidden;}

.wrap #mainContent{padding: 20px 20px 0 5px; font-size:12px; overflow:hidden;}
.wrap #mainContent h1/*,.wrap #mainContent h2,.wrap #mainContent h3*/{background:#3c5a98/* url(h1bg.png)*/; color:#fff;}

.bodytext,p{background:#fff;}

.wrap #footer{padding: 0 10px 0 0; } .wrap #footer p{margin: 0; /* zeroing the margins of the first element in the footer will avoid the possibility of margin collapse - a space between divs */  padding: 10px 0; /* padding on this element will create space, just as the the margin would have, without the margin collapse issue */}.fltrt{ /* this class can be used to float an element right in your page. The floated element must precede the element it should be next to on the page. */  float: right;  margin-left: 8px;}.fltlft{ /* this class can be used to float an element left in your page */  float: left;  margin-right: 8px;}.clearfloat{ /* this class should be placed on a div or break element and should be the final element before the close of a container that should fully contain a float */  clear:both;    height:0;    font-size: 1px;    line-height: 0px;}ul#menu{display:block;list-style:none;padding:0;margin:0;margin-top:120px;width:420px;float:left;}#menu li{float: left;  background:#1f1a14;  border:2px solid #1f1a14;  color:#fff;  font-weight:bold;  margin:4px 4px;  padding:0 4px;}#menu li a{color:#fff;  font-weight:bold;  font-size:18px;  line-height:32px;  text-decoration:none;}#menu li.act{float: left;  background: #C9A597;  border:2px solid #1f1a14;  color:#1f1a14;  font-weight:bold;  margin:4px 4px;  padding:0 4px;}#menu li.act a{color:#1f1a14;  font-weight:bold;  font-size:18px;  line-height:32px;  text-decoration:none;}#mainContent a,#sidebar1 a{text-decoration:none;  border-bottom:dotted 1px #1f1a14;  color:#1f1a14;  font-weight:bold;}#mainContent a:hover,#sidebar1 a:hover{border-bottom:solid 1px #1f1a14;}a img{border:none;  } hr{border:1px #fff solid; background:#fff;}
